Ellipticity meaning


Ellipticity is a term used in mathematics and physics to describe the degree of deviation from a perfect circle or sphere. It is a measure of how much an object or shape deviates from being perfectly round or spherical. In this article, we will provide tips on how to use the word ellipticity in a sentence.
